4.7 Internal links

For the field distributor SK DA-130E, the elements attached are connected directly with the components of the
frequency inverter. For this, there are the following links, which are explained subsequently with the help of a
connection diagramme.

• The supply voltage connected [Line In] is the feed for field distributor and frequency inverters. This is

connected from feeding [Line In] via the repair switch to the inverter input. The inverter/motor can
therefore be turned off for repair/maintenance.

• The motor output of the frequency inverter is connected directly to the system connector Harting HAN

10E [drive]. The repair switch connects this motor output to the inverter on/off.

• Te voltage emitted by the SK 300E for the brake (180V DC) is guided directly to the motor output

[drive]. CAUTION: Here, you must take care that a brake of a coil voltage of 180 DC has been
mounted. Otherwise, the wiring should be changed.

• The connections of the temperature sensor have been guided to the digital input 1 of the SK 300E via

motor connection [drive], which, by standard, is responsible for analysis. Through this, the inverter
monitors the temperature of the motor, realising the protection of the motor.

• The M12 terminal sockets of the I/Os (I/O 1 to I/O6) are supplied with 24V as soon as a 24V supply is

connected to the terminal socket ”24V Ext.“ or the terminal block ”24V_I/O“.



Æ

I/O 1 both constitute a digital input and the output of the multi-finctional relay (MFR). Via this multi-

functional relay , a 24V voltage is applied, so that the 24V can be applied separately via the bus (digital
output 24V). The signals are always connected directly with the customer interface of the SK 300E, the
“standard I/O“. The digital input constitutes the dig-in 2 of the customer interface, the digital output 24V
comes from the multi-functional relay. In the standard version, the Pin 2 is connected to the Pin 5 of I/O5 in
order to have an additional 24V output for the activation of a SK 160E.

Link to SK 140E/SK 150E: With this terminal, an SK 140E, SK 150E or SK 160E can be fully controled via
a cable. This also includes the supply voltage of the starter (24V), the input to start (RUN-R/RUN-R), as
well as the feedback (OK)
(See

p.15).


Æ I/O 2 to I/O6 represent digital inputs, which are connected directly with the customer interface of the
SK 300E, the standard I/O.


Æ All imported and issued control signals can both be used as drive functions and as control functions
via the bus system.
